Her short, brown fur splattered with paint, '''Moselle, the [[Ty Beirdd]] humgii''', spends her free time gnawing on a [[journal]] in the [[library]] of the Ty Beirdd [[:Category:Houses|House]] estate. The pockets of her Lyricist's vest are stuffed with fortune cookies and glasses of absinthe instead of writing materials. Like other humgii, she will eat anything that is given to her, especially written works authored by House novices.

Moselle was discovered at Centre Crossing in [[Cyrene]], where she wobbled about splattering everything with paint. Upon hearing of a homeless humgii with an interest in the arts, members of Ty Beirdd offered her a home in their House estate. After being given a tour, Moselle chose to live in the library, where she remains to this day, placidly waiting to be fed.
